免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ios 上架证书

iOS 上架证书是指在将应用程序上传到 App Store 前需要进行签名的证书。签名后的应用程序才能在设备上运行,否则会提示无法信任开发者。本文将介绍 iOS 上架证书的原理和详细步骤。

iOS 上架证书的原理

iOS 上架证书是一种数字证书,用于证明开发者身份和应用程序的完整性。在将应用程序上传到 App Store 前,需要使用开发者账号生成一个证书请求文件,然后将该文件上传到苹果开发者中心,由苹果签署生成一个证书,最后将证书下载并安装到本地电脑上进行应用程序签名。

使用 iOS 上架证书的好处是可以保证应用程序的安全性和可信度,防止应用程序被篡改或恶意攻击。

iOS 上架证书的步骤

1. 注册开发者账号

在开始 iOS 开发前,需要先注册一个苹果开发者账号。可以通过以下网址进行注册:https://developer.apple.com/

2. 生成证书请求文件

在注册开发者账号后,需要生成一个证书请求文件。可以使用 Keychain Access 工具生成该文件。具体步骤如下:

1)打开 Keychain Access 工具,在菜单栏中选择“Certificate Assistant” -> “Request a Certificate from a Certificate Authority”。

2)填写证书请求信息,包括名称、电子邮件地址和 CA 电子邮件地址等。

3)选择证书类型为“Saved to disk”,然后保存证书请求文件到本地电脑上。

3. 上传证书请求文件

在生成证书请求文件后,需要将该文件上传到苹果开发者中心进行签名。具体步骤如下:

1)打开苹果开发者中心,选择“Certificates, Identifiers & Profiles” -> “Certificates” -> “Add”.

2)选择“iOS App Development” 证书类型,然后上传证书请求文件。

3)等待苹果签署证书,并下载生成的证书。

4. 安装证书

在下载证书后,需要将证书安装到本地电脑上进行应用程序签名。具体步骤如下:

1)双击下载的证书文件,将证书添加到 Keychain Access 工具中。

2)在 Xcode 中选择项目,然后在“Build Settings” 中选择“Code Signing” -> “iOS Developer”。

3)选择刚刚安装的证书进行应用程序签名。

总结

iOS 上架证书是保证应用程序安全性和可信度的重要手段。在进行应用程序签名前,需要注册开发者账号并生成证书请求文件,然后上传文件到苹果开发者中心进行签名,最后将证书安装到本地电脑上进行应用程序签名。这些步骤虽然繁琐,但是可以保证应用程序的安全性和可靠性。


相关知识:
苹果签名失败怎么办
苹果签名失败是指在使用苹果设备或者iTunes进行更新或者安装应用时,系统提示签名失败的错误。这个错误通常会出现在系统更新、应用安装、越狱、恢复设备等操作中。这个错误的出现会导致设备无法更新或者无法安装应用,给用户带来很大的困扰。那么,苹果签名失败的原因和
2023-04-07
苹果掉证书无线网址
苹果掉证书无线网址是指利用苹果iOS系统的漏洞,通过在设备上安装企业级证书,从而通过无线方式安装未经苹果官方审核的应用程序。这种方式被称为“掉证书”或“越狱”。掉证书的原理是通过在设备上安装一个企业级证书,使得设备认为这个证书是可信的,从而可以下载并安装未
2023-04-07
苹果如何扫描证书二维码
苹果设备可以通过扫描证书二维码来验证证书的真实性。这个过程的原理是利用了苹果设备内置的Safari浏览器和证书验证的机制。首先,需要了解什么是证书二维码。证书二维码是一种包含证书信息的二维码,可以通过扫描二维码来验证证书的真实性。这种二维码通常被放置在证书
2023-04-07
苹果助手签名失败
苹果助手签名失败是指在使用苹果助手安装应用程序时,出现了签名失败的情况。这种情况通常是由于应用程序的签名证书过期或无效导致的。下面将详细介绍苹果助手签名失败的原理和解决方法。1. 签名证书过期或无效苹果助手安装应用程序时需要使用签名证书,签名证书是由苹果公
2023-04-07
添加苹果开发者证书时
苹果开发者证书是开发者进行应用程序开发和发布所必需的一种数字证书,它包含了开发者的身份信息和公钥,用于验证应用程序的身份和完整性。在苹果开发者中心申请开发者证书后,开发者需要将证书添加到本地的钥匙串中,以便在构建和签名应用程序时使用。添加苹果开发者证书的步
2023-04-07
苹果ipa签名使用教程
苹果IPA签名是指将iOS应用程序打包成IPA文件,并使用数字证书进行签名,以便在设备上进行安装和使用。在iOS设备上安装非官方应用程序时,需要进行签名,如果不进行签名,则无法安装。下面是苹果IPA签名使用教程的详细介绍。1. 生成证书首先,需要生成一个开
2023-04-07
苹果12搞笑签名
苹果12作为一款备受瞩目的智能手机,其功能和性能都非常强大,但在使用过程中,我们也可以添加一些搞笑的签名来增加乐趣。下面就来介绍一下苹果12搞笑签名的原理和详细操作方法。一、什么是签名在苹果12中,签名是指在短信、邮件、社交媒体等应用中添加的一段文本,用于
2023-04-07
ios更新后证书用不了了怎么回事
当你更新iOS操作系统后,你可能会遇到证书无法使用的问题。这通常是由于操作系统更新导致的。在iOS操作系统中,应用程序必须使用证书进行签名才能在设备上运行。这些证书是由苹果公司颁发的,并且在过期或iOS操作系统更新后必须重新申请。在本文中,我们将详细介绍为
2023-04-07
ios打签名
在iOS开发中,签名是一个非常重要的环节,它可以保证应用程序的安全性,防止应用程序被篡改或者被恶意软件替换。那么,iOS打签名到底是什么呢?本文将为您详细介绍iOS打签名的原理和过程。一、什么是签名?在iOS开发中,签名是指对应用程序进行数字签名,以保证应
2023-04-07
ios开发者证书疑问
iOS开发者证书是一种用于签署和发布iOS应用程序的数字证书。它是由苹果公司颁发的,用于确认应用程序的开发者身份和应用程序的完整性。在这篇文章中,我们将详细介绍iOS开发者证书的原理和使用方法。一、iOS开发者证书的原理iOS开发者证书采用了公钥加密和数字
2023-04-07
ios15签名安装ipa
iOS 15 是苹果公司最新发布的操作系统,其中包含了许多新特性和改进。对于开发者和测试人员来说,安装和运行自己的应用程序是非常关键的一步。但是,由于 iOS 系统的限制,开发者在设备上安装自己的应用程序需要进行签名操作。在本文中,我们将讨论如何在 iOS
2023-04-07
ios 自签名ssl证书
SSL证书是一种用于保护网络通信安全的协议,它可以确保数据传输的隐私性、完整性和可信性。在iOS设备上,我们可以使用自签名SSL证书来实现网络通信的安全性。本文将介绍iOS自签名SSL证书的原理和详细操作步骤。一、SSL证书的原理SSL证书是一种数字证书,
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4